Zelda Romhacks

I've been going through several of the more recent Zelda 2, Zelda LTTP, & OoT romhacks and of them I found these to be quite good:
>Interconnected Strongholds - LTTP
>Allhallows Eve - LTTP
>The Shadow's Fall - LTTP
>Amida's Curse - Zelda 2
>Master of Time - OoT

I really prefer the dungeon design in Interconnected Strongholds/Allhallows Eve over any other LTTP romhack currently - same author for both Letterbomb so I think that's a name to pay attention to. Feels like stuff Nintendo might actually do dungeon & puzzle wise. And they have a good degree of challenge too. The Shadow's Fall, another recent LTTP hack also had good dungeon design but it was on the shorter more atmospheric storytelling side. Starts hard though - gets much easier after first dungeon. The first two though - I'm glad we actually have good LTTP romhacks finally that aren't pure Kaizo like Parallel Worlds was. Amida's Curse is just really strong all around - lots of dungeons and a big world to explore. Good balancing - different spell order but it works. Master of Time is just a very very impressive romhack all around - only real issue is the author getting bored and making those endings - there is a Malon hack of it that fixes the ending but I have yet to play it past the opening so I can't comment. I also need to go through Ultimate Trial which is supposed to be really good as well.
